Output 62cbb551a134f7f5c4f78619215368b5a2e594767a6d876d42b064bc36ea6551:6

value
21536755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5686fcfccd53235af066b376fcefd1d5993c49fa OP_EQUAL
address
MFng45GcNHghgn7avgz9v9GHPkqrqhAa3k
transaction
62cbb551a134f7f5c4f78619215368b5a2e594767a6d876d42b064bc36ea6551
spent
true